The XPG turbohead is a re-badge of the mini-turbohead found on the G&P "X" series (X-6, X-9, X-12; 2, 3, and 4 CR123 powered respectively). They never really caught on as being super popular for various reasons but they are a nice balance of size and throwing power. The "D36" standard became much more popular as it was found in the Wolf-Eyes and Pila flashlights, and then LumensFactory came along and made after-market lamps for those... The G&P implementation of the mini-turbo had one major failure, and that was the near complete lack of easy to find replacement bulbs for them. They take a bulb and bulb base very similar to the "screw in" style found on most of the G&P/etc(spiderfire/ultrafire/superfire/xpg etc) D26 style lamps, but the bulb position has to be slightly different to focus properly in the larger turbo reflector. With no cost effective way to replace the bulbs in these, they just didn't stand a chance against other options. The only way to replace the bulb at this time seems to be to just buy a whole new head... If you could always get the whole head for $15 then that would be fine, but they are normally a fair bit more expensive than that, which makes it a little hard to justify... The "X" series from G&P are harder and harder to find lately too, the scorpion style li-ion powered turbo-head lights seem to have almost completely replaced them in most resellers inventory.

Just for the sake of example, I'll throw this link in to one of the more modern revisions of the old "X" series lights. This should be using the same bulb style that your turbohead uses, just a different external head design... (this sold under the spiderfire name, which all seems to be under the "G&P/related" umbrella.)

http://cgi.ebay.com/Spiderfire-X-02...hash=item280279084377&_trksid=p3286.m63.l1177

These mini-turbo heads from G&P draw ~1.2-1.4A depending on the various revision of the bulb... There were variations over the years but they were all essentially the same concept and same ballpark of output. This load is within reason leaning on a little high for regular protected RCR123s. Safety shouldn't be an issue unless it is routinely used in a continuous run, ordinarily, flashlights are used in short bursts so it shouldn't be too bad. The IMR cells may give you a slightly noticeable increase in output/whiteness. More importantly, the IMR cells will give you much better cycle life and safety at this drain rate, so that alone would be worth the switch. The runtime wouldn't be much different as the IMR16340s come very close to the capacity of regular RCR123s in this size.

As for building a "200+" lumen light in this size... Keep in mind that as far as bulb lumens are concerned, your XPG mini-turbo head is already probably up around 200 bulb lumens, or around 125 torch lumens, (give or take).. Exact numbers are so far from being important as you really can't see small difference anyways.... but an upgrade to a true solid 200 "torch" lumens would probably be something slightly noticeable... The issue is going to be, that most of the options that have a solid 200+ torch lumens, are either available in the D26 size class, or you have to move up to a full blown 2.5" surefire turbohead (KT2).... When you start to throw in differences in beam pattern, lumen differences don't show up as each light has certain strengths. If you don't mind a KT2 kit for your light, which is a pretty beefy turbohead, then it's a really neat setup and you can start to play with a ton of options, especially if you get a FM bi-pin to MN adapter. With that adapter you can play with a lot of bulbs, all the way up to a WA1111 or 64250 in a little 2x16340 host... Which is more like 400-500 torch lumens... but only for a few minutes on those cells, hehe... For that "200" torch lumen range, the GE787 (bi-pin) or HO-M3T (lumensfactory) are great options.

Hi guys, I have this light in a different flavor. 12V xpg body with the Cabelas turbo head, here`s the kicker. Take apart the T head,remove reflector/lamp assembley. Now carefully unscrew the bulb/spring from the reflector.

Take a Lumens Factory HO-9, unscrew the bulb from its reflector. You guessed it , Screws right into the XPG turbo head. Reassemble your now 9V turbo head. Add 2x 17670 Li-ion batteries,you are done = FLASHENSTIEN/ poor mans rechargable SF M-4. 320 bulb lumens

FYI : The Cabelas XPG heads also fit Surefire C body lights if you need a little more punch for your 6/9 P or Z.

A new company now sells these lights. They are named DigiTec. A hot link is way over my pay grade and skill level so you will have to use google for yourself. I know it's hard but you can do it. One of you whiz kids can hot link to it for some of us old geezers. Thanks. The 9V and 12V bulbs are available by themselves. The 12V turbo head lamp assembly is $24 and the 9V LA is $20. The 12V TH is for a 227 lumen bulb and it is less than Surefire charges for any 200 lumen lamp assembly. To my Mark 1 eyeball it puts out an honest 220 lumens. I have both the 12V turbo head and a 12V lamp assembly that fits inside the standard SF P/C head, the Z44. They make for GREAT lights. I use one on a Leef 4 battery body and the other is on a SF 9P body with an extender. I use only primaries with them both. I just never got into rechargables. I have never understood why they were not more popular. A 12V light with a standard head fits perfectly into the long pocket of pair of painters pants or painters jeans (Wrangler). That is a great way to walk around with 200 lumens on you all the time. It has good throw AND is a wall of light. It is much cheaper than a SF M4. My turbo head model rides in my briefcase. It is the brightest, large light that will fit. My SF M4 won't fit. Several times I was awfully glad to have it with me. I call them 12P's, like a 6P or 9P. See my lights below.
